Prussia. An Order Of The Red Eagle, Second Class Star, By Hossauer, C.1860 Newly Listed he served with the Rifle(Preuische Rote Adlerorden Bruststern zur II. Klasse). A silver star with a gold cross pattee with four white enameled arms; the obverse with an enameled Brandenburg crowned eagle, surrounded by a broad white enameled ring, inscribed Sincere et Constanter (Latin Sincere and Persistent) in gold lettering; the reverse with a vertical pin, and a functional hinge catch assembly; marked by perhaps the foremost maker of Prussian orders, 15 Lth Hossauer,
